摘要
Water inventory control plays an important role in the research of supply chains of water resources of South-to-North Water Transfer. Based on the practical conditions of water resources allocation in China, the article chooses the node lake of water resources supply chains of South-to-North Water Transfer as the research object and uses water ordering quantity raised by the downstream district as the decision-making variable. It also establishes a central control decision-making model of water resources supply chains under the conditions of asymmetrical information. Finally, thorough the positive analysis of Dongping Lake, it proves the validity of the model.
